The racing earlier this month was the Roar Before the 24. An official IMSA testing session for the race later this month. I keep track of the team on MINIRaceFan.com. You can find all of the information there for watching the race.
Here's a link to the Daytona event schedule. Events run from the 26th to the 27th. Daytona is a 4 hour endurance race this year

Unfortunately they don't post the race online until after the Fox Sports broadcast. The broadcast is Sunday, February 12, 2017 from 1:30 PM to 4:00 PM EST.
Yep they took a 4 hour race and edited down to 2 1/2 hours. That probably takes a while and is why they are waiting 16 days after the race to finally broadcast it.
The good news is that IMSA has been posting the full live stream broadcast of the event online lately instead of the heavily edited FS1 one. You can expect that to be up shortly after the FS1 broadcast.

Well, how'd Team MINI JCW do yesterday at Sebring? I think I saw where #73 finished 4th in class. Anyone go? I would have been there if I still lived in south Florida but like a dumb snowbird I sit inside with the remnants of a blizzard still outside! I thought Spring was suppose to be here! lol!
The 73 did indeed finish 4th. The 37 was 11th and 52 was 13th. It was an exciting race to watch. There was some real hard racing throughout.
